Jamie Laing admits he was ‘pretty selfish’ before he became a father

Jamie Laing has shared a heartfelt reflection on life after embracing fatherhood following the birth of his son, Ziggy.

The former Made in Chelsea The 37-year-old star revealed he is balancing the demands of running his business with the day-to-day responsibilities of looking after his newborn after his wife Sophie Habboo gave birth in December, who is seven months old.

Sharing the candid statement, Jamie wrote: ‘I want to be real for a minute. I’m in the trenches right now. Ziggy is 7 months old.

‘And it’s been hard running my business while juggling parenthood while trying to see friends. Harder than I was ever told it would be. Harder than (honestly) I was prepared for.’

Reflecting on what his life was like before parenthood, Jamie revealed that he could get up and do whatever he wanted because his business was his only concern. He said: ‘Before I was a dad I was a bit selfish to be honest haha. I would wake up and do what I wanted. Gym, coffee run, walk.

‘Work would seep into times it shouldn’t – early mornings, late nights, events. My business was all I really had to worry about.

He continued: ‘Now my baby holds a book of my days. He is my first thing and my last thing. And the time in between is spent just cramming in as much as I possibly can.

‘If you too are in the trenches right now, just know you are not alone. It’s mental. But that’s the best kind of mental.’

Alongside his sweet words, Jamie posted a video of some key moments from the first seven months of Ziggy’s life.

Jamie is currently on holiday in Mallorca with Ziggy and his wife Sophie.
